The Symbolism and Mythology Behind Bull Horns
Since ancient times, bull horns have symbolized virility, strength, and resilience. In many civilizations, from Greek mythology to Native American traditions, the bull represented wild power and fertility—often linked to gods, fertility rituals, or heroic tales.
- Greek Mythology: The Minotaur, locked in his labyrinth, had the head of a bull and horns that symbolized untamed raw power.
- Celtic Cultures: Bull horns adorned ceremonial artifacts, embodying strength and sovereignty.
- Animal Mythology: Across cultures, the bull’s horns are commonly seen as protective talismans or symbols of thunder and the earth’s fertility.
